  • What is a Line Up Service?

    A line up service involves shaping the hairline to achieve a sharp, defined look. This matters in Chesapeake, VA, as local options are limited to just one expert provider. Hairline precision is vital for a polished appearance. Common techniques include using clippers and razors for clean edges.

  • Frequently Asked Questions


  • How often should you get a line-up?
  • For optimal results, most barbers suggest getting a line-up every one to two weeks, especially if maintaining sharp, clean edges is your priority.


  • Can a line-up be personalized?
  • Yes, line ups can be customized based on your hairstyle and facial structure, helping to highlight features and create a balanced, polished look.


  • What should I ask my barber before a line-up?
  • Discuss your preferred style, any concerns you have about the shaping, and inquire about maintenance tips to keep the look fresh.


  • Are line-up services suitable for all hair types?
  • Generally, yes. Skilled barbers can adapt techniques to suit various hair types, ensuring that everyone can achieve a clean, defined appearance.
